## Google AI Overviews Priority Assessment
Google AI Overviews typically represent the highest immediate priority for UK small businesses due to their integration with existing search behaviour patterns. UK consumers already use Google for business research, making AI Overview visibility a natural extension of current customer acquisition channels rather than requiring behaviour change adoption.
The technical barriers to Google AI Overview optimisation often prove more manageable for small businesses with limited resources. The platform builds upon existing SEO foundations while requiring enhanced entity clarity and meaning architecture that benefit overall digital marketing effectiveness beyond AI visibility alone.
Google AI Overviews also provide measurable impact assessment through existing analytics infrastructure, allowing small businesses to evaluate ROI and optimisation effectiveness using familiar measurement frameworks rather than developing entirely new performance tracking systems.
## ChatGPT Recommendation Potential
ChatGPT offers significant recommendation visibility opportunities for small businesses operating in advice-driven industries or complex service categories where customers seek detailed guidance before making decisions. The platform's conversational nature allows small businesses to demonstrate expertise depth and practical problem-solving capabilities that traditional search results cannot convey effectively.
